Orders can be started and suspended for later recall. To suspend an order use the button located at the top of the screen. This will save the order for later recall allowing you to ring up other customers in the meantime.


To recall an order that was suspended or from a previous sale use the button and choose the order from the list:

The recall order list can be filtered using the buttons along the bottom to show orders with different statuses: All orders, Voided, Paid or open orders.

You can also bring up orders from previous business dates by choosing the button and selecting the required date.

Switching from the List to Information tab will show you information about the selected order's status. Use the Item Returns tab to return any items from the order depending on your store's policy.



You can re-open an order that has been paid by selecting the button in the bottom left of the screen. This will bring you back to the order screen where you can either delete items or reduce their quantity. This will take the items off the order and refund them to the customer. 


Once you have finished removing items from the order you can select the button and choose the appropriate 'payment' option to refund the customer.


You can also use the button to refund and void out an entire order. 


Select the Void Order button and enter the reason for the void:
